The disease classifications of peripheral artery disease include the stages one through five with number 1 being Asymptomatic 2. Mild claudication 3. Moderate-to severe claudication 4. Ischemic rest pain and number 5 being Ulceration or gangrene. Moreover, knowing the early diagnosis is, quite frankly important for improving the quality of life for the patient and also reducing the risk of serious secondary vascular events. Some risk factors for PAD include obesity, age, hypertension, sedentary lifestyle, dyslipidemia, smoking, hyperhomocysteinemia and diabetes mellitus. On the other hand, PAD is linked with increased risk of additional cardiovascular complications such as a stroke, MI and with it being left untreated may lead to other serious problems such as amputation and gangrene. This type of disease is known to be a set of acute or chronic syndromes that are generally consequential from the company of occlusive arterial disease which also causes insufficient blood flow to the limbs. Nevertheless, dealing with the pathophysiological view, ischemia of the lower extremities is classified as critical or functional. Functional ischemia is when the flow of the blood is normal at rest, but inadequate during any type of exercise while Critical ischemia occurs when the reduction of the blood flow results at rest and is well-defined by the attendance of pain.
